Identifying Wavy Caps in Your Backyard

Are you looking to find those buy wavy caps online fascinating mushrooms that sometimes pop up in backyards? Learning wavy caps can be a rewarding experience. These unique mushrooms often have a distinctive wavy or undulating shape to their pilei. They usually appear on the ground, preferring moist conditions. Note that while some wavy caps are consumable, others can be poisonous. It's always best to refer an expert before consuming any wild mushrooms.

If you think you might have found a wavy cap, capture a picture from multiple angles and notice its color, size, shape. Employ a field guide or online tool to help identify the species.

A Forager's Guide to Wavy Caps

When searching for edible Wavy Caps, remember to focus on vibrant woodland habitats. These fungi thrive in damp locations, often nestled among decomposinglogs. Take note of their distinctive fan-shaped caps and pale stalks. A keen eye for detail will help you spot these treasures, making your foraging adventure a rewarding one.

  • Prior to consuming any wild fungi, it is crucial to verify its identity with an experienced forager or through reliable resources.
  • Avoid foraging in areas that may have been sprayed to pesticides or herbicides.
  • Constantly practice ethical foraging, taking only what you need and leaving the rest for others to enjoy.
